Brief Life History of Warren Dannel

When Warren Dannel Matthews was born on 13 February 1923, in Glenbar, Graham, Arizona, United States, his father, James Daniel Matthews, was 38 and his mother, Annie Eliza Follett, was 35. He married Glenna Carrie Marise Bodine on 23 December 1941, in Pima, Graham, Arizona, United States. He lived in Tucson, Pima, Arizona, United States in 2001 and Pima, Arizona, United States in 2006. He died on 25 July 2006, in Pima, Graham, Arizona, United States, at the age of 83, and was buried in Pima Cemetery, Pima, Graham, Arizona, United States.

Name Meaning

English and Irish (Ulster and County Louth): patronymic from the personal name Matthew . In North America, this surname has absorbed various cognates from other languages, such as German Matthäus (from the personal name Matthäus, from Latin Matthaeus) and Slovenian Matavž (from an obsolete vernacular form of the personal name Matevž, from Latin Matthaeus). Compare Mathews .

Irish: Anglicized form of Mac Mathghamhna (see McMahon ).
